在机器学习领域,性能优化是提升模型训练和推理效率的关键。Linux系统以其灵活性和稳定性成为许多数据科学家的首选平台。通过合理配置Linux环境,可以显著提升机器学习任务的执行速度。
选择合适的Linux发行版是第一步。Ubuntu、Debian和CentOS等主流发行版提供了丰富的软件包支持,同时具备良好的社区资源。安装时建议选择最小化安装,避免不必要的服务占用系统资源。
硬件层面的优化同样重要。确保使用高速SSD作为系统盘,增加内存容量以支持大规模数据处理。对于GPU加速任务,安装NVIDIA驱动和CUDA工具包是必要的步骤。
AI绘图结果,仅供参考
内核参数调优能够进一步释放系统潜力。例如,调整swap空间、优化I/O调度器和关闭不必要的后台进程,都可以提升整体性能。同时,使用实时内核(RT Kernel)可减少延迟,适合对响应时间敏感的任务。
软件环境的配置也不容忽视。安装最新版本的Python、PyTorch或TensorFlow,并确保依赖库的兼容性。使用虚拟环境管理项目,避免不同版本之间的冲突。
•监控和日志分析是持续优化的基础。利用工具如htop、iostat和Prometheus,可以实时跟踪系统状态,及时发现瓶颈并进行调整。